Best Holden Public Preschools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 530 students in Holden, MO.
The top-ranked public preschool in Holden, MO is Holden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Holden, MO public preschool have an average math proficiency score of 52% (versus the Missouri public pre school average of 35%), and reading proficiency score of 51% (versus the 37% statewide average). Pre schools in Holden have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Missouri public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 11%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Missouri public preschool average of 36% (majority Black).
